Fashion Week is roaring
into New York. The tents are up in Bryant Park for
the invitation-only IMG Mercedes Benz Fashion Week.
And all over the city, non-tent-showing designers
(either too big or too small for the tents) are
preparing their shows. And all around the world,
magazine editors and store buyers have packed their
bags and left for New York, where they will be dazzled
once again by the exuberance and talent of the New
York fashion world.

Dries Van Noten
September 2009's
Spring 2010 Fashion Week will be rung in by the
Couture Council's Awards Luncheon at the Cipriani
on September 9, 2000. This year's award recipient
is Dries Van Noten.
Here is a quote from the Couture Council's press
release:
"Dries van Noten will
receive The Couture Council of The Museum at FIT’s
fourth annual Artistry of Fashion award at a benefit
luncheon at Cipriani 42nd Street in New York city
on Wednesday, 9 September 2009. FIT’s glamorous
annual gala luncheon, will be hosted by its founding
Couture Council chairs Liz Peek, Yaz Hernandez,
and Sarah Wolfe, and founding luncheon chair Charlotte
Moss. The event, for the fourth year in a row is
the first event of New York’s fashion week.

Mercedes Benz Fashion Week may
be the giant in the room, there are three other
fashion week sponsors during fashion week: Style
360 at the Metropolitan Pavilion; Couture Week at
the Waldorf Astoria; and Nolcha Fashion Week.

Style 360 will also be rolling
out the red carpet during Fashion Week. Style 360
will feature invitation only shows and parties for
three days and three night at the Metropolitan Pavilon
in Chelsea. Style 360 is know for the blending of
fashion and products and this year will be no different.
